The DTA143EUA-TP is a semiconductor product belonging to the category of bipolar transistors. This device is commonly used in electronic circuits for amplification and switching applications due to its specific characteristics. The DTA143EUA-TP is available in a variety of packages and quantities, making it suitable for different electronic designs.
The DTA143EUA-TP has three pins: 1. Emitter (E) 2. Base (B) 3. Collector (C)
The DTA143EUA-TP operates based on the principles of bipolar junction transistors. When a small current flows into the base terminal, it controls a larger current flow between the collector and emitter terminals, allowing for amplification or switching of signals.
The DTA143EUA-TP is commonly used in the following applications: - Audio amplifiers - Signal amplification circuits - Switching circuits - Oscillator circuits
